The Power of Oneness | Edwin Fillies 06.05.2026 41minIn this episode, Edwin Fillies brings a stirring message on what it really means to be one. Rooted in John 17, the High Priestly Prayer, Edwin unpacks how the oneness Jesus prays for is not just unity, but a complete, Spirit-wrought oneness modelled on the love between the Father and the Son. Through stories spanning Cape Town, Uganda, Australia, and beyond, he shows us what that love looks like when it gets its hands dirty - crossing racial lines, sitting with the marginalised, and entering into friendships that the world would never expect. Edwin argues that you can run every programme, go on every outreach, and still never truly love if you never cross the line from helping people to belonging to them. This message will challenge the way you think about mission, compassion, and what it really means to love the way Jesus loved. -

The Life of Aaron | Caleb Cox 19.02.2026 48minIn this episode, Caleb Cox explores the life of Aaron and what it means to be called a holy priesthood through 1 Peter 2:4. From miracles and priestly garments to the failure of the golden calf, Aaron’s story holds both glory and weakness in tension. Yet after his greatest failure, he was still anointed by God as leader. This episode reminds us that God’s calling over your life is not cancelled by your worst moment. -
